The thirteenth season of Akademi Fantasia, also branded as AF2016, premiered on 21 August 2016 and concluded on 9 October 2016 on the Astro Ria television channel. Zizan Razak returned as host along with his new partner, Alif Satar, [1] [2] while Ramli M.S. continued to judge and AC Mizal joined the judging panel following the departure of Rozita Che Wan.

North and South is the sixth studio album by Gerry Rafferty.It was Rafferty's first studio album in six years and reunited him with producer Hugh Murphy. The album was released as an LP and CD in 1988.
Gerry Mulligan Quartet Volume 1 is an album by saxophonist and bandleader Gerry Mulligan featuring performances recorded in 1952 and originally released as the first 10-inch LP on the Pacific Jazz label. [1] [2] In 2001 Pacific Jazz released an album on CD with additional tracks from Mulligan's first five recording sessions.
